The Role
We are looking for a highly motivated engineer who is driven to deliver innovative products that keep customers safe. Must be a self-starter and work effectively cross?functionally. Working as an Electrical Module Design Release Engineer (DRE) provides a strong foundation of leadership skills.
The Electrical Module HW DRE is responsible for definition of requirements, execution of design, analysis, development, testing, and management of engineering projects for Electrical Module components where creativity, initiative, and independent judgment are involved. Additionally, the Electrical Module DRE provides technical direction over a Product Development Team consisting of engineers and engineering support personnel.
This role is responsible for the technical project management and design release of a wireless charging system, including managing supplier timing, running PDT meetings, issue investigation and resolution, and ensuring part deliveries to benches, vehicle retrofits, and assembly plants.
